What Are Sliding Doors?
Sliding doors are big panels that move open and closed, usually set up in locations where traditional hinged doors may not be feasible. visit the next site are regularly used for outdoor patios, closets, and room dividers. The advantages of sliding doors consist of:
- Space Efficiency: Unlike conventional doors, sliding doors do not swing open, enabling ideal area usage even in compact rooms.
- Natural Light: Large glass panels enable natural light to enter the home, creating a brighter and more welcoming environment.
- Aesthetic Appeal: Sliding doors can improve the total style of a space, functioning as an attractive centerpiece.

The Installation Process
Working with a professional involves several steps to make sure a smooth installation procedure. Here's an overview of what to anticipate:
Consultation and Estimate:
- The installer sees your home to assess the installation location.
- Discuss your choices and budget plan.
- The installer provides a price quote based upon your requirements.
Preparation:
- The installer prepares the area by eliminating any existing components and guaranteeing a clean workplace.
- This may include eliminating old doors, fixing surrounding frames, or producing an assistance structure.
Installation:
- The sliding door frame is put together and protected into the prepared opening.
- Unique attention is paid to leveling and positioning to guarantee the door operates smoothly.
- Extra sealing and insulation steps are implemented to enhance energy effectiveness.
Completing Touches:
- Final adjustments are made to the sliding door mechanism.
- The installer may apply any needed weather condition stripping and clean the work location.
Post-Installation Checks:
- The installer will test the door's performance and make any last-minute changes, ensuring that it meets quality standards.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)
What is the typical lifespan of a sliding door?
- Sliding doors typically last in between 20 to 30 years, depending on the material and maintenance.
Can I set up a sliding door myself?
- While DIY installation is possible, employing professionals guarantees better results and decreases the danger of mistakes.
What maintenance do sliding doors require?
- Routine cleaning, lubrication of the tracks, and examining seals for wear and tear are important for maintenance.
What should I consider when choosing a sliding door?
- Evaluate your requirements in regards to space, insulation, style, and spending plan before making an option.
Are sliding doors energy efficient?
- Modern sliding doors, particularly those with double or triple glazing, can offer considerable energy effectiveness.
